Spinach Dip

Ingredients 2 tbsp. extra-virgin olive oil 6 oz. baby spinach 8 oz. light cream cheese 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ese 1 cup grated parmesan cheese 1 cup sour cream 1 egg 5-6 cloves garlic, minced Salt and pepper, to taste Directions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Blend together cream cheese, mozzarella cheese, egg, parmesan, and sour cream with an electric mixer on medium speed, about half a minute. Add olive oil to a large, shallow pan and set to medium heat. Sautee spinach with minced garlic, until both are soft. Season lightly with salt and pepper. Add the spinach and egg to the cream cheese mixture, and blend with electric mixer on medium speed for about 15 seconds. Add salt and pepper.
